A curly, hand-drawn calligraphic roman with mostly monoline strokes and rounded terminals. Letterforms rely on generous loops, small swashes, and occasional spiral-like counters, creating a lively silhouette with varied character widths. Curves are smooth and consistent, with a slightly bouncy rhythm and open, readable bowls in both cases. Numerals echo the same decorative logic, with several figures featuring curled entry/exit strokes and spiral accents.

The font conveys a lighthearted, charming tone—more playful than formal—while still feeling intentional and neatly drawn. Its curls and flourishes suggest a vintage, crafty sensibility suited to whimsical, human-centric messaging.
The design appears intended to mimic careful hand lettering with consistent stroke weight, adding personality through curls and modest swashes rather than connected script. It aims to remain legible while providing an ornamental, upbeat texture across both uppercase and lowercase.
Capitals are especially decorative, with pronounced lead-in curls and soft, rounded construction that stands out in short words. In longer text, the repeated loops create an ornamental texture, so spacing and line length will influence how airy or busy the overall color feels.
